Output ec70150a91274b80d3d7cc6eb7aabd1763f35a7e1286a8ccd9b67b5f44b4684e:4
- value
- 11760606695
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3ee20c73649bb9645f6fa27daa37addf5ef2ea5
- address
- tb1qu0hzp3ekfxaev30klgna4gm6mh677t492624ny
- transaction
- ec70150a91274b80d3d7cc6eb7aabd1763f35a7e1286a8ccd9b67b5f44b4684e
- confirmations
- 32923
- spent
- true